<p>The paper describes solutions of the Laplace–Beltrami equation on a two-dimensional two-sheeted hyperboloid for three non-subgroup coordinate systems: semi-circular parabolic, elliptic parabolic and hyperbolic parabolic. The coefficients of interbasis expansions of solutions in these coordinates through some subgroup bases are calculated. A contraction procedure for all normalized eigenfunctions in the specified coordinate systems from the hyperboloid to the Euclidean plane is realized.</p>
